Introduction

Some 4Runner vehicles may exhibit a condition where the HVAC control panel illumination is dim flickering or intermittently inoperative. A newly designed light bulb has been made available to resolve this concern.

Warranty Information

APPLICABLE WARRANTY

^ This repair is covered under the Toyota Comprehensive Warranty. This warranty is in effect for 36 months or 36,000 miles, whichever occurs first, from the vehicle's in-service date.

^ Warranty application is limited to occurrence of the specified condition described in this bulletin.

Repair Procedure





1. Confirm that the customer's concern is of a dim, flickering, or intermittently inoperative HVAC illumination panel in the area shown in Figure 1.

2. Remove the air conditioning control assembly.





Refer to the Technical Information System (TIS), applicable model year 4Runner Repair Manual:





3. Replace the 2 light bulbs for the HVAC control panel illumination circuit. (Refer to Figure 2.)

Using a small flat blade screwdriver turn the light bulbs counter clockwise to remove and clockwise to install/tighten.

4. Install the air conditioning control assembly.





Refer to TIS applicable model year 4Runner Repair Manual:

5. Confirm the HVAC Control Panel Illumination and Controls are operating correctly.
